Brief summary
Single-center randomized trial in patients with pacing indication (AV block) after TAVI (transfemoral aortic valve implantation) and LVEF\> 50%, that aims to study the percentage of patients who improve at 12 months in a combined clinical endpoint.
Detailed description
There is currently no evidence of the best mode of definitive pacing after TAVI in patients with preserved systolic ventricular function and AV block. Through this study, investigators intend to elucidate the best post TAVI pacing strategy, comparing the effect of right apical pacing vs. physiological pacing on the evolution of both echocardiographic and clinical parameters. Investigators will include 24 patients without ventricular dysfunction (LVEF\> 50%) and with AV block pacing indication after TAVI. Patients will be randomized to 2 types of pacing (parallel randomized trial): physiological or right ventricular pacing (conventional). PHYS-TAVI trial will analyze the following parameters in the 2 groups: survival; NYHA class; distance in the 6-minute walking test; hospital admissions; left ventricular function; echocardiographic asynchrony (strain and flash septal); NTproBNP; and quality of life/symptoms with the Kansas City Cardiomyopathy Questionnaire test (KCCQ-12) Clinical, and echocardiographic follow-up will be performed for 1 year.
Interventions
Pacing of the his bundle or the left bundle branch
Conventional pacing; right ventricular pacing

Masking description
The patient will be explained to be randomized to either of the two branches. The type of therapy applied will not be communicated to the patient. The follow-up will be the same in the two branches. During the visits, it will not be said which therapy has been applied. The echocardiographer and the follow-up by the Hemodynamic Team will be blind.
Eligibility
Inclusion criteria
* Successful implantation of TAVI according to VARC-2 criteria. * Indication of cardiac pacing due to AV block according to ESC Guidelines. * LVEF\> 50%. * The patient must indicate their acceptance to participate in the study by signing an informed consent document.
Exclusion criteria
* Ventricular dysfunction: LVEF \<50%. * Transapical TAVI. * Participating currently in a clinical investigation that includes an active treatment. * Patients with left bundle branch block but without indication of pacing (AV block). * Life expectancy \<12 months.
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Clinical combined endpoint: survival; and improvement > 1 point in NYHA class or > 25% increase in the distance covered in the 6-minute walking test. | 12 months | Determine the percentage of patients who improve at 12 months on a clinical combined endpoint: survival; and improvement \> 1 point in NYHA class or \> 25% increase in the distance covered in the 6-minute walking test. |
Secondary
| Measure | Time frame | Description |
|---|---|---|
| Correction of echocardiographic asynchrony: septal flash expressed in mm. | 30 days; 12 months | Correction of septal flash determined with echocardiography (M mode). |
| Distance covered in the 6-minute walking test. | 30 days; 12 months | Distance in meters walked in 6 minutes. |
| Change in NYHA functional class. | 30 days; 12 months | NYHA functional class I, II, III, IV. |
| Change in degree of mitral regurgitation. | 12 months | Mitral regurgitation measured with echocardiography. |
| Change in left ventricular ejection fraction. | 12 months | Left ventricular ejection fraction (LVEF %) measured with Simpson method with echocardiography (Delta left ventricular ejection fraction: 12 months LVEF - baseline LVEF). |
| Hospitalization due to heart failure. | 12 months | Hospitalization: patient hospitalization (yes/no). |
| QRS duration | Implant; 12 months | QRS duration (milliseconds) measured with a 12-lead ECG (in the electrophysiology lab polygraph) |
| Score on quality of life/symptoms Questionnaire (KCCQ-12 Kansas City Cardiomyopathy Questionnaire ) | 30 days; 12 months | Score in KCCQ-12: higher=better. |
| Correction of global longitudinal strain | 30 days; 12 months | Global longitudinal strain assessed with two-dimensional speckle-tracking echocardiography |
| Change in NTproBNP. | 30 days; 12 months | NTproBNP blood levels. |
